AI generated Summary: Drawing from the analogy of a man clinging to a rope instead of dropping into waiting arms, the sermon explores the root of unbelief as a manifestation of self-righteousness and a refusal to relinquish control. It argues that the common complaint of "I can't believe" stems not from a lack of desire but from an unwillingness to surrender to God's finished work, preferring to rely on personal effort and preparation. The message emphasizes the simplicity of the Gospel and the need for the Holy Spirit to overcome this ingrained resistance, ultimately calling listeners to embrace God's free grace and trust in His provision rather than clinging to self-sufficiency.
